What is Happening Here? •The president, he has signed executive orders that •Restrict entry of immigrants from seven countries into the U.S. •Authorize the construction of a wall along the U.S. border with Mexico. •Signed an order to prioritize the removal of “criminal aliens” and withhold federal funding from “sanctuary cities.”

What is an executive order? • An executive order is an official statement from the president which tells government agencies how to use their resources. • In the case of “Muslim Ban” the order bars citizens of seven Muslim-majority countries from entering the US for a period of 90 days. • It suspends the United States' refugee system for a period of 120 days. • Trump says his "extreme vetting" system will help "keep radical Islamic terrorists out of the US". •

Is the executive order legally binding? • Executive orders are legally binding and are recorded in the Federal Register, a daily record of all federal regulations, proposals, and public notices. • But they can be subjected to a legal review according to the New York Times, the "Muslim ban" order is illegal. • The Immigration and Nationality Act of 1965 banned all discrimination against immigrants on the basis of national origin. • Trump's travel ban is a violation of that act.

How does it affect refugees? • The ban completely suspends the United States' Syrian refugee program, which accepted 12,486 Syrians in 2016. • Gives preference to accepting Christian refugees from the Middle East over Muslim refugees. • Reduces cap on the total number of refugees allowed to enter the US in 2017 from 110,000 to just 50,000.

Who does it affect? • The order refers to a statute which applies to seven Muslim- majority nations. • Syria, Iran, Sudan, Libya, Somalia, Yemen and Iraq, with dual nationals included in the ban. • There have been reports of legal US residents, known as green card holders, being turned away from US-bound flights. • Green cards are not mentioned explicitly in the executive order. • Oddly, the ban does not apply to the nationalities of those who carried out the 9/11 attacks: • Saudi Arabia, the United Arab Emirates and Egypt.
  • 8. Who does it affect? • Approximately thirteen percent • of the world’s Muslims, or 199.4 million • out of up to 1.6 billion, • live in those seven countries Pew Research Report (2015 )“The Future of World Religions: Population Growth Projections, 2010-2050.”

What the Ban Did • Suspended the entire US refugee admissions system • for 120 days • even though it was already one of the most rigorous vetting • regimens in the world, • taking 18 to 24 months and requiring interviews and background checks through multiple federal agencies. • Trump has said he wants more strictures

What is Happening? • Suspended the Syrian refugee program indefinitely. • The US accepted 12,486 Syrian refugees in 2016, compared with about 300,000 received by Germany the same year. • Since the Syrian civil war began, Turkey has received about 2.7 million refugees, • Lebanon 1 million refugees • Jordan 650,000, according to UN estimates.

Banned • From Entry seven majority-Muslim countries • Iran, Iraq, Libya, Somalia, Sudan, Syria and Yemen – for 90 days. • After perhaps the vaguest of Trump’s orders, there was much confusion in the first 36 hours over whether legal US residents would be allowed to enter the US. • They were initially denied entry, but on Sunday night, the Department of Homeland Security (DHS) announced that some “legal permanent residents” who pose no “serious threat” to the US would be allowed in on a case-by-case basis. • It is unclear whether this would extend to those in possession of work or student visas. • The order would let the Department of Homeland Security ban more countries at any time

What happens next? • Opponents of the "extreme vetting" order say they will launch a legal challenge on two fronts. • They are expected to argue that the blanket ban violates the FIFTH Amendment right to due process. • They will argue that the order's preferential treatment of Christians over Muslims violates the FIRST Amendment on Freedom of Religion.

Crime and Immigration • Research has shown that increases in immigration are NOT associated with increases in crime. • Immigration-crime research over the past 20 years that found no backing for the immigration-crime connection. • The literature demonstrates that immigrants commit fewer crimes, on average, than native-born Americans. • Large cities with substantial immigrant populations have lower crime rates, on average, than those with minimal immigrant populations.

  • 18. Mem Fox, 70, Australian author wrongfully detained at LA airport • I was pulled out of line in the immigration line at Los Angeles airport as I came into the US. Not because I was Mem Fox the writer – nobody knew that – I was just a normal person like anybody else. They thought I was working in the States and that I had come in on the wrong visa. • I was coming to deliver an opening speech at a literacy conference, and because my expenses were being paid, they said: “You need to answer further questions.” So I was taken into this holding room with about 20 other people and kept there for an hour and 40 minutes, and for 15 minutes I was interrogated.
  • 19. Mem Fox Children’s Book Author • En route to a conference, where she was to deliver the opening address at a literacy conference, Fox was ushered into an airport holding room and told she was travelling on the wrong visa. • This was incorrect and the US Embassy in Canberra has apologized. Fox, 70, said that by the time she checked in to her hotel she was shaking and sobbing. • “I am old and white, innocent and educated, and I speak English fluently,” she said. “Imagine what happened to the others in the room, including an old Iranian woman in her 80s, in a wheelchair. • “The way I was treated would have made any decent American shocked to the core, because that’s not America as a whole, it really isn’t. It’s just that people have been given permission to let rip in a fashion that is alarming.”
  • 20. Muhammad Ali's son detained at Ft. Lauderdale airport because he's Muslim • The son of legendary boxer Muhammad Ali was detained by immigration officials at Ft. Lauderdale-Hollywood International Airport because he's a Muslim. • Muhammad Ali Jr., along with his mother, Khalilah Camacho-Ali were returning to Florida from Jamaica after speaking at a black history event. Both had valid US Passports. • Chris Mancini, the attorney for the Ali family said the incident stemmed from President Donald Trump's executive order calling for a temporary travel ban on foreign nationals entering the country from seven Muslim-majority countries in the Middle East and Africa. • "He asked me, 'what is your name?' " Ali Jr. "Which I didn't think nothing of that." The 44-year-old American citizen, born in Philadelphia added that the official asked for the origins of his name. He said, my father and mother named me. "He said, 'OK, now, what is your religion?' " Ali Jr. said. "And I said, 'Muslim, I'm a Muslim.' And I thought to myself, that's kind of odd. He asked about my religion, and I'm traveling back into the country from where I came from?" Ali Jr. said the immigration official questioned him in separate room from his mother

Donald Trump announces new immigrant crime agency - and pledges to publish lists of crimes by 'aliens’ The President claimed that murders were being kept quiet by 'special interests' • "I have ordered the Department of Homeland Security to create an office to serve American victims," he said in the speech. • "The office is called VOICE — Victims Of Immigration Crime Engagement. We are providing a voice to those who have been ignored by our media, and silenced by special interests." • The Department of Homeland Security clarified that VOICE will come under the auspices of ICE, and that ICE will publish the list of crimes committed by immigrants
  • 22. With VOICE Agency, Trump Continues 'Nativist Demonization' of Immigrants: New government agency blasted as 'a blatant attempt to humiliate and scare immigrants' • "I am establishing the Victims of Immigration Crime Engagement (VOICE) Office within the Office of the Director of ICE, which will create a programmatic liaison between ICE and the known victims of crimes committed by removable aliens" • "To that end, I direct the Director of ICE to immediately reallocate any and all resources that are currently used to advocate on behalf of illegal aliens to the new VOICE Office, and to immediately terminate the provision of such outreach or advocacy services to illegal aliens." • An executive order from Trump, signed in late January, also instructed DHS to "make public a comprehensive list of criminal actions committed by aliens."

What can Happen Now? • President Trump's Department of Justice has several options to challenge Thursday's ruling by a federal appeals court, which refused to reinstate the temporary travel ban targeting seven majority-Muslim countries. • 1. Go the Supreme Court, that would be difficult, 4-4 Tie? • 2. Go to Appeals Court, 3 Judge Panel: • This could be difficult, because the San Francisco court is the most liberal in the country. 18 of the judges were appointed by Democratic presidents compared to seven appointed by Republicans. • 3. Go back to Washington State, Judge James Robart: • The ruling from the 9th Circuit only deals with the temporary restraining order issued by District Judge James Robart on Feb. 3. • 4. Go Write a New Executive Order

Keep Your Eyes Wide Open • The corporation that deports immigrants has a major stake in Trump’s presidency, “There’s a lot of money to be made.” • If Trump’s plan to deport 2 or 3 million more immigrants comes to pass, ICE will almost certainly turn to private industry. • CSI Aviation, Trump has stake in this company, has received more than $300 million dollars in contracts to provide the Department of Homeland Security with air passenger service. • In fact, nearly every step of the detention and deportation process has become an opportunity for private businesses to cash in. The detention facilities are not only operated by companies, but the services inside them — healthcare, food, phone systems — are contracted out to specialized firms. • ICE has relied on private flights to deport immigrants for migrants from Central America. ICE Air has contracted with commercial airlines and charter flight companies operating out of four U.S. airport hubs to take people either back to their country of origin or to another detention center within the United States.
